Brief Explanations
- A hypothesis is a testable prediction. "Plants grow better in sunlight than in shade" can be tested by comparing plant growth in sunlight and shade. The other statements are general statements not testable in a scientific - experiment sense.
- In an experiment, the independent variable is what the scientist changes on purpose to observe its effect on the dependent variable.
- A thermometer measures temperature and a balance measures mass. A graduated cylinder (not in the options) is used to measure liquid volume, but among the given options, there is no correct answer for measuring liquid volume.
